class InfNFeAType

Class representing InfNFeAType

Methods

string
getVersao()

Gets as versao

setVersao(string $versao)

Sets a new versao

string
getId()

Gets as id

setId(string $id)

Sets a new id

getIde()

Gets as ide

setIde(IdeAType $ide)

Sets a new ide

getEmit()

Gets as emit

setEmit(EmitAType $emit)

Sets a new emit

getAvulsa()

Gets as avulsa

setAvulsa(AvulsaAType $avulsa)

Sets a new avulsa

getDest()

Gets as dest

setDest(DestAType $dest)

Sets a new dest

getRetirada()

Gets as retirada

setRetirada(TLocalType $retirada)

Sets a new retirada

getEntrega()

Gets as entrega

setEntrega(TLocalType $entrega)

Sets a new entrega

addToAutXML(AutXMLAType $autXML)

Adds as autXML

boolean
issetAutXML(scalar $index)

isset autXML

void
unsetAutXML(scalar $index)

unset autXML

getAutXML()

Gets as autXML

setAutXML(array $autXML)

Sets a new autXML

addToDet(DetAType $det)

Adds as det

boolean
issetDet(scalar $index)

isset det

void
unsetDet(scalar $index)

unset det

getDet()

Gets as det

setDet(array $det)

Sets a new det

getTotal()

Gets as total

setTotal(TotalAType $total)

Sets a new total

getTransp()

Gets as transp

setTransp(TranspAType $transp)

Sets a new transp

getCobr()

Gets as cobr

setCobr(CobrAType $cobr)

Sets a new cobr

addToPag(PagAType $pag)

Adds as pag

boolean
issetPag(scalar $index)

isset pag

void
unsetPag(scalar $index)

unset pag

getPag()

Gets as pag

setPag(array $pag)

Sets a new pag

getInfAdic()

Gets as infAdic

setInfAdic(InfAdicAType $infAdic)

Sets a new infAdic

getExporta()

Gets as exporta

setExporta(ExportaAType $exporta)

Sets a new exporta

getCompra()

Gets as compra

setCompra(CompraAType $compra)

Sets a new compra

getCana()

Gets as cana

setCana(CanaAType $cana)

Sets a new cana

Details

at line 166
string getVersao()

Gets as versao

Versão do leiaute (v2.0)

Return Value

string

at line 179
InfNFeAType setVersao(string $versao)

Sets a new versao

Versão do leiaute (v2.0)

Parameters

string $versao

Return Value

InfNFeAType

at line 192
string getId()

Gets as id

PL_005d - 11/08/09 - validação do Id

Return Value

string

at line 205
InfNFeAType setId(string $id)

Sets a new id

PL_005d - 11/08/09 - validação do Id

Parameters

string $id

Return Value

InfNFeAType

at line 218
IdeAType getIde()

Gets as ide

identificação da NF-e

Return Value

IdeAType

at line 232
InfNFeAType setIde(IdeAType $ide)

Sets a new ide

identificação da NF-e

Parameters

IdeAType $ide

Return Value

InfNFeAType

at line 245
EmitAType getEmit()

Gets as emit

Identificação do emitente

Return Value

EmitAType

at line 259
InfNFeAType setEmit(EmitAType $emit)

Sets a new emit

Identificação do emitente

Parameters

EmitAType $emit

Return Value

InfNFeAType

at line 273
AvulsaAType getAvulsa()

Gets as avulsa

Emissão de avulsa, informar os dados do Fisco emitente

Return Value

AvulsaAType

at line 287
InfNFeAType setAvulsa(AvulsaAType $avulsa)

Sets a new avulsa

Emissão de avulsa, informar os dados do Fisco emitente

Parameters

AvulsaAType $avulsa

Return Value

InfNFeAType

at line 300
DestAType getDest()

Gets as dest

Identificação do Destinatário

Return Value

DestAType

at line 314
InfNFeAType setDest(DestAType $dest)

Sets a new dest

Identificação do Destinatário

Parameters

DestAType $dest

Return Value

InfNFeAType

at line 328
TLocalType getRetirada()

Gets as retirada

Identificação do Local de Retirada (informar apenas quando for diferente do endereço do remetente)

Return Value

TLocalType

at line 342
InfNFeAType setRetirada(TLocalType $retirada)

Sets a new retirada

Identificação do Local de Retirada (informar apenas quando for diferente do endereço do remetente)

Parameters

TLocalType $retirada

Return Value

InfNFeAType

at line 356
TLocalType getEntrega()

Gets as entrega

Identificação do Local de Entrega (informar apenas quando for diferente do endereço do destinatário)

Return Value

TLocalType

at line 370
InfNFeAType setEntrega(TLocalType $entrega)

Sets a new entrega

Identificação do Local de Entrega (informar apenas quando for diferente do endereço do destinatário)

Parameters

TLocalType $entrega

Return Value

InfNFeAType

at line 385
InfNFeAType addToAutXML(AutXMLAType $autXML)

Adds as autXML

Pessoas autorizadas para o download do XML da NF-e

Parameters

AutXMLAType $autXML

Return Value

InfNFeAType

at line 399
boolean issetAutXML(scalar $index)

isset autXML

Pessoas autorizadas para o download do XML da NF-e

Parameters

scalar $index

Return Value

boolean

at line 412
void unsetAutXML(scalar $index)

unset autXML

Pessoas autorizadas para o download do XML da NF-e

Parameters

scalar $index

Return Value

void

at line 425
AutXMLAType[] getAutXML()

Gets as autXML

Pessoas autorizadas para o download do XML da NF-e

Return Value

AutXMLAType[]

at line 440
InfNFeAType setAutXML(array $autXML)

Sets a new autXML

Pessoas autorizadas para o download do XML da NF-e

Parameters

array $autXML

Return Value

InfNFeAType

at line 455
InfNFeAType addToDet(DetAType $det)

Adds as det

Dados dos detalhes da NF-e

Parameters

DetAType $det

Return Value

InfNFeAType

at line 469
boolean issetDet(scalar $index)

isset det

Dados dos detalhes da NF-e

Parameters

scalar $index

Return Value

boolean

at line 482
void unsetDet(scalar $index)

unset det

Dados dos detalhes da NF-e

Parameters

scalar $index

Return Value

void

at line 494
DetAType[] getDet()

Gets as det

Dados dos detalhes da NF-e

Return Value

DetAType[]

at line 508
InfNFeAType setDet(array $det)

Sets a new det

Dados dos detalhes da NF-e

Parameters

array $det

Return Value

InfNFeAType

at line 521
TotalAType getTotal()

Gets as total

Dados dos totais da NF-e

Return Value

TotalAType

at line 535
InfNFeAType setTotal(TotalAType $total)

Sets a new total

Dados dos totais da NF-e

Parameters

TotalAType $total

Return Value

InfNFeAType

at line 549
TranspAType getTransp()

Gets as transp

Dados dos transportes da NF-e

Return Value

TranspAType

at line 563
InfNFeAType setTransp(TranspAType $transp)

Sets a new transp

Dados dos transportes da NF-e

Parameters

TranspAType $transp

Return Value

InfNFeAType

at line 576
CobrAType getCobr()

Gets as cobr

Dados da cobrança da NF-e

Return Value

CobrAType

at line 590
InfNFeAType setCobr(CobrAType $cobr)

Sets a new cobr

Dados da cobrança da NF-e

Parameters

CobrAType $cobr

Return Value

InfNFeAType

at line 605
InfNFeAType addToPag(PagAType $pag)

Adds as pag

Dados de Pagamento. Obrigatório apenas para (NFC-e) NT 2012/004

Parameters

PagAType $pag

Return Value

InfNFeAType

at line 619
boolean issetPag(scalar $index)

isset pag

Dados de Pagamento. Obrigatório apenas para (NFC-e) NT 2012/004

Parameters

scalar $index

Return Value

boolean

at line 632
void unsetPag(scalar $index)

unset pag

Dados de Pagamento. Obrigatório apenas para (NFC-e) NT 2012/004

Parameters

scalar $index

Return Value

void

at line 644
PagAType[] getPag()

Gets as pag

Dados de Pagamento. Obrigatório apenas para (NFC-e) NT 2012/004

Return Value

PagAType[]

at line 658
InfNFeAType setPag(array $pag)

Sets a new pag

Dados de Pagamento. Obrigatório apenas para (NFC-e) NT 2012/004

Parameters

array $pag

Return Value

InfNFeAType

at line 672
InfAdicAType getInfAdic()

Gets as infAdic

Informações adicionais da NF-e

Return Value

InfAdicAType

at line 687
InfNFeAType setInfAdic(InfAdicAType $infAdic)

Sets a new infAdic

Informações adicionais da NF-e

Parameters

InfAdicAType $infAdic

Return Value

InfNFeAType

at line 701
ExportaAType getExporta()

Gets as exporta

Informações de exportação

Return Value

ExportaAType

at line 716
InfNFeAType setExporta(ExportaAType $exporta)

Sets a new exporta

Informações de exportação

Parameters

ExportaAType $exporta

Return Value

InfNFeAType

at line 730
CompraAType getCompra()

Gets as compra

Informações de compras (Nota de Empenho, Pedido e Contrato)

Return Value

CompraAType

at line 744
InfNFeAType setCompra(CompraAType $compra)

Sets a new compra

Informações de compras (Nota de Empenho, Pedido e Contrato)

Parameters

CompraAType $compra

Return Value

InfNFeAType

at line 757
CanaAType getCana()

Gets as cana

Informações de registro aquisições de cana

Return Value

CanaAType

at line 771
InfNFeAType setCana(CanaAType $cana)

Sets a new cana

Informações de registro aquisições de cana

Parameters

CanaAType $cana

Return Value

InfNFeAType